Sudsy News - New Editor
Guest Author - Cheryl Lewis

The soapmaking edititor is Winsome Tapper who has been making soap for the last five years. She makes cold process, hot process, melt and pour and rebatched soaps. She believes that becoming an editor at Bellaonline gives her the chance to share her expertise on one of her favorite topics. A self-taught artist and writer, Winsome is at home with many different creative media. She has worn many hats professionally, having worked as a network analyst, a fraud investigator, and a chef. Winsome will be pursuing a graduate degree in Speech Language Pathology.

Her interest in soap making was an obvious extension of her love for herbs and floral crafts. She gathered this experience and love from a childhood spent in the rural countryside on the island of Jamaica. It was in the shade of the Blue Mountains, where vegetation would pop up overnight, so fertile was the soil, in a parish that had one of the heaviest rainfall on the island, that a love for all manner of trees, bushes, herbs, flowers, rocks and anything natural took hold. Because of this, Winsome has a strong commitment to eco-friendly manufacturing practices and to use ingredients as natural based as possible. To her it is imperative to leave as little footprint as possible on the earth, for future generations.

Her love of soap making naturally turned into a business, when everyone wanted to buy the products she made. Winsome is tireless in her efforts to source out eco-friendly and fair trade ingredients for body care and soap manufacturing. She has amassed a huge inventory of information and sources that would be of help to those making soap and body care products as a hobby and as a business.
